
Video game designer Richard Lemarchand’s games include the Uncharted series; currently, he is a visiting associate professor at the USC Interactive Media Division. Before participating in a panel on the role of gaming in education, he talked in the Zócalo green room about sweating and roller skating, and why you can’t pay too much for a haircut or play an overrated video game.
